SOURCE: Audi 2.5 tdi Quattro Avant
I don't think this is possible. Your AFB engine requires an AFB-compatible ECU. The AFB code is specific to that engine design due to parameters of the engine itself. My 99 A4 has the AHA V6 30v engine, which can only be controlled by an AHA ECU. Changing the ECU does not change the engine itself, and trying to use an ECU from a different engine code will not work. If you want to use a different engine, you'd need that new engine's ECU, engine bay harness, accessories and mounts, and possibly even the chassis harness from the donor car. It'd be a tremendous amount of work.
